[−][src]Enum casperlabs_engine_shared::transform::Error
Error type for applying and combining transforms. A TypeMismatch
occurs when a transform cannot be applied because the types are
not compatible (e.g. trying to add a number to a string). An
Overflow
occurs if addition between numbers would result in the
value overflowing its size in memory (e.g. if a, b are i32 and a +
b > i32::MAX then a AddInt32(a).apply(Value::Int32(b))
would
cause an overflow).
Variants
Serialization(Error)
TypeMismatch(TypeMismatch)
